证券公司信息系统架构设计及实施策略是确保公司运营效率、数据安全和客户服务质量的关键。下面我将详细阐述证券公司信息系统架构的设计原则、关键组成部分以及实施策略。
一、设计原则
1. 高可用性和可靠性:确保系统在面对各种故障时,依然能够持续运行。这包括使用冗余组件、定期备份数据和实现自动故障转移机制。
2. 安全性:保护敏感数据免受未授权访问和攻击。这需要多层次的安全措施,包括但不限于防火墙、入侵检测系统、加密技术以及定期的安全审计和漏洞扫描。
3. 可扩展性:随着业务的发展,系统应能够轻松地添加新功能或扩展现有服务,以适应市场变化和客户需求的增长。
4. 灵活性和适应性:系统架构应具备高度的灵活性,以便快速响应市场变化和新技术的出现。这可能涉及到模块化设计、微服务架构等。
5. 合规性:确保系统符合所有相关的法律法规要求,如证券交易法规、数据保护法规等。
二、关键组成部分
1. 基础设施层:这是整个系统的基础,包括服务器、存储设备、网络设备等。这些硬件设施需要具备高性能、高稳定性和高可用性。
2. 应用层:包括前端界面、后端逻辑、数据库等。这一层负责处理用户请求、执行业务逻辑并返回结果。
3. 数据层:存储和管理所有业务数据。数据层需要保证数据的完整性、准确性和一致性,同时提供高效的数据查询和更新能力。
4. 安全层:包括身份验证、授权、加密等安全措施,以防止未经授权的访问和攻击。
5. 监控与报警:实时监控系统性能和异常情况,及时发出报警,帮助运维团队快速定位问题并进行修复。
三、实施策略
1. 需求分析:在项目开始之前,深入理解业务需求和技术约束,明确系统的功能、性能、安全等方面的要求。
2. 技术选型:根据业务需求和技术发展趋势,选择合适的技术和工具进行系统开发。例如,可以选择云计算平台、大数据处理框架、人工智能算法等。
3. 分阶段实施:将系统开发分为多个阶段,每个阶段完成一部分功能的开发和测试。这样可以降低风险,提高项目的成功率。
4. 持续集成与持续部署:通过自动化的构建和测试流程,确保代码的质量和稳定性。同时,实现快速迭代和发布,满足业务的快速变化。
5. 培训与支持:为员工提供必要的培训,确保他们能够熟练使用系统和工具。同时,建立完善的技术支持体系,解决用户在使用过程中遇到的问题。
总之,证券公司信息系统架构设计及实施策略需要综合考虑系统的可用性、安全性、扩展性、灵活性和合规性等多个方面。通过合理的设计和实施,可以确保系统的稳定运行,为客户提供优质的服务,同时也保护公司的利益不受损害。